Most sold industrials stocks in Q1 2026
See which Industrials stocks institutional investors trimmed or exited the most in Q1 2026, measured as net reductions in reported share positions from Q4 2025 into Q1 2026. Notable reductions at the top of this list include RTX CORP (RTX), HILLENBRAND INC (HI), REV GROUP INC (REVG), SYMBOTIC INC (SYM). These rankings aggregate SEC 13F filings from all institutional investors in our database.

How is institutional selling calculated?
Selling is calculated by summing the net decrease in shares reported by institutional investors between two consecutive quarterly 13F snapshots (compared to Q4 2025).
Does this include all institutional owners?
Yes. These rankings aggregate SEC 13F filings from all institutional investors in our database, not only the investors we track individually.
Are these trades real-time?
No. 13F filings are reported quarterly and may be delayed by up to 45 days. The data reflects positions at the end of the reporting period, not real-time trading activity.
